About Ivan Bartoli

Ivan Bartoli is a scholar working on Mechanics of Materials, Civil and Structural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Ocean Engineering and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 104 papers that have together received 3.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Ultrasonics and Acoustic Wave Propagation (81 papers), Structural Health Monitoring Techniques (51 papers), Non-Destructive Testing Techniques (49 papers), Geophysical Methods and Applications (21 papers), Thermography and Photoacoustic Techniques (9 papers), Railway Engineering and Dynamics (9 papers), Optical measurement and interference techniques (6 papers) and Numerical methods in engineering (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Mechanics of Materials (2.4k cit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(1.6k citations), Ocean Engineering (839 citations), Mechanical Engineering (1.3k citations) and Geophysics (162 citations). Ivan Bartoli has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Italy and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include Francesco Lanza di Scalea, Alessandro Marzani, Erasmo Viola, Howard Matt, Matteo Mazzotti, Antonios Kontsos, Piervincenzo Rizzo, Stefano Coccia, Mahmood Fateh and Salvatore Salamone.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of the Acoustical Society of America, Ultrasonics, Journal of Intelligent Material Systems and Structures, Journal of Sound and Vibration and Structural Control and Health Monitoring.
